Overview

SupplyOn Performance Management allows suppliers to access and analyze their KPI performing with ZF in a new standardized and structured format.


ZF defines its own evaluation of the Operational Evaluation - KPIs: Quality, Logistics and Top Level - KPIs: Business Fundamentals, Sustainability, Digitalization and Escalation.

SupplyOn Performance Management is connected to ZF's system, from where it monthly receives updated supplier ratings. Some current key performance indicators include...

These ratings are critical to understanding how you are performing relative to ZF’s expectations which will impact escalation and/or future sourcing decisions.

Benefits

Use of the SupplyOn Performance monitor provides both ZF and suppliers with a number of benefits...

  • Replacement from PerMo.
  • Customization of dashboard making easier the user experience.
  • Standardized mandatory digital process across ZF Group, Company, Plant and locations.
  • Transparent and up-to-date feedback for continuous improvement
  • Standardized mandatory digital process across ZF Group, Company, Plant and locations.
  • The new interface “API” optimizes the data preparation and Calculation from 15 hrs. to 30 minutes.
